A little tangential, but having just been in an argument here with someone who advocated a "nightwatchman state," I wonder what they'd think of the USDA's efforts here (as well as the other governments'). It seems almost impossible that this could have been coordinated by private industry alone: while there's an obvious benefit to the cattle industry, it seems hardly likely that they would have sponsored the years of investment in basic research that led to this, let alone successfully negotiated with Panama for the rights to dump irradiated bugs from coast to coast. Could it have been done?

It's also striking how much these efforts were made harder by US foreign policy and involvement in the wars of Central America, and are still made hard because of our poor relationship with Cuba.

I wonder what would happen if instead of releasing sterile male screwworms, we used the gene drive to release screwworms that could only have male descendants. I've heard of a similar idea to eradicate malaria by doing that to mosquitoes.

The article says they are working on it: “Biologists are also developing a genetically modified male-only strain of screwworms, which would require fewer flies to be raised and released.”
